CITY OF MEDINA
RESOLUTION NO. 92-118
RESOLUTION ACCEPTING BID FOR HAMEL WELL NO. 4
WHEREAS, pursuant to an advertisement for bids for the construction of a new
municipal well in the southwest corner of the old reservoir site along Pinto Drive
( Hamel Well No. 4) , bids were received, opened and tabulated according to iaw and
the bids received which complied with the advertisement are summarized on Exhibit
A attached hereto; and
WHEREAS, it appears that E. H. Renner & Sons, Inc. is the lowest responsible
bidder.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of Medina,
Minnesota as follows:
1. The mayor and clerk -treasurer are hereby authorized and directed to
enter into a contract with E.H. Renner & Sons, Inc. of Elk River,
Minnesota in the name of the City of Medina for construction of Hamel
Well No. 4, according to the plans and specifications approved by the
city council and on file in the office of the clerk -treasurer.
2. The clerk -treasurer is hereby authorized and directed to return
forthwith to all bidders the deposits made with their bids, except that
the deposits of the successful bidder and the next lowest bidder shall
be retained until a contract has beei ,. igned .
Dated: December 15, 1992.
